Retention of Configuration in Photolytic Decarboxylation of Peresters to Form Chiral Acetals and Ethers.

[摘要]Peresters generate ethers in good yields when photolyzed in the absence of solvent using short wavelength UV light. At -78癈 or below, the process proceeds predominantly with retention of configuration at the site adjacent to the carbonyl where the decarboxylation occurs, but increase in temp. results in loss of stereochem. control. Chiral acyclic acetals can be prepd. using precursors derived from tartaric or malic acids.
